Unexpected Chocolate Pairings for Sweet Tooths
Let’s start with the basics. Chocolate goes great with a lot more than just milk and sugar. For those with a sweet tooth, try pairing chocolate with caramel, peanut butter, or even marshmallows for a deliciously decadent treat. If you’re feeling adventurous, try pairing dark chocolate with salty snacks like potato chips or pretzels for a unique twist on the classic sweet and salty duo.
Unique Flavors to Add to Your Chocolate Mix
But why stop at just sweet flavors? Chocolate pairs surprisingly well with some unexpected flavors like chili, bacon, and even cheese! For a spicy kick, try adding some crushed chili flakes to your dark chocolate. For meat lovers, adding crumbled bacon to milk chocolate is a savory delight. And for those who love cheese, try pairing dark chocolate with a sharp cheddar for a surprisingly delicious combination.
Surprising Chocolate Combinations to Satisfy Your Cravings
If you’re looking for something truly unique, there are plenty of exotic flavors to explore. Matcha green tea and chocolate make for a perfect pairing, while the rich, nutty flavor of tahini goes surprisingly well with dark chocolate. For a fruity twist, try mixing milk chocolate with dried apricots or cranberries for a sweet and tangy treat.
Exotic Treats: Unusual Flavors that Elevate Your Chocolate Experience
Looking for something truly off the beaten path? Try some unusual flavor pairings to take your chocolate experience to the next level. We love the combination of dark chocolate with balsamic vinegar or even red wine. For a more herbaceous flavor, try mixing dark chocolate with rosemary or even thyme.
Unconventional Chocolate Partnerings for a Tasty Twist
Ready to get really creative? We’ve found that chocolate pairs well with some unexpected ingredients like avocado, red pepper, and even olive oil! For a creamy, rich treat, try mixing dark chocolate with mashed avocado. For a hint of spice, add some finely chopped red pepper to your melted chocolate. And for a luxurious touch, drizzle some high-quality olive oil over your favorite chocolate bar.
